AUDI S5 2025 LANE DEPARTURE: BLIND SPOT DETECTION
high
Since the day of delivery, this 2025 Audi S5 has experienced daily electronic and safety system failures. At least once per day, on startup, the vehicle throws 10 or more warning codes disabling safety-critical systems including blind spot monitoring, lane departure warning, forward collision avoidance, rear traffic alert, and adaptive lighting. These failures occur without warning and persist for varying durations before clearing on their own. Additionally, on 5 occasions the adaptive cruise control refused to activate, displaying a false "door open" warning with all doors and trunk confirmed closed. On 4 occasions the power trunk failed to latch using the electronic controls. The 360-degree parking camera system intermittently stops rendering surroundings, displaying only the vehicle graphic with no camera feed. The vehicle was brought to the selling dealer for service. After one hour, the dealer stated no issue was found. A battery diagnostic was requested based on a documented case of an identical 2025 S5 with the same symptoms traced to a faulty 12V battery. The dealer declined to cover the diagnostic under warranty. The service manager later acknowledged these are known platform issues and confirmed a software update is expected from the manufacturer in July 2026. The vehicle already has the latest available software update (TSB 2079690, KD2, version 03.10.00/C) installed and the problems persist. The dealer has confirmed there is no current fix available. These failures put the driver and other road users at risk, as safety systems are non-functional during the error state with no indication of when they will restore.

AUDI S5 2025 ENGINE
medium
Known-Best Assesment-Piston Skirt Defect and Non-Disclosure of Prior Issues: Approximately only three months after purchase of a brand new 2025 Audi S5 on 6/11/25 , I received a letter from Audi of America acknowledging a potential piston skirt defect/failure resulting from faulty material and/or workmanship. They extended the part warranty for 8 years or 80,000 miles but this doesn't help me feel safe driving this vehicle. I was informed the defect cannot be proactively repaired and would only be addressed after failure. This instruction is unreasonable, unsafe, and contrary to the purpose of purchasing a new vehicle. Audi has previously settled piston-related class litigation, yet no one at Audi Henderson disclosed any history of piston issues during the sale. Had I been informed of this material risk, I would not have purchased the vehicle. I now feel unable to safely or confidently use this vehicle for long-distance or out-of-state travel.
